Transaction 363e2cd66b2657f61f79027086a33afc5a60d4daff98751c4678de0e594eab36

1 Input
2 Outputs
  • 363e2cd66b2657f61f79027086a33afc5a60d4daff98751c4678de0e594eab36:0
  • value  37952
    address  12BEHFSG1TGE7A6VvhvHY73UNTiQt7hBTd
  • 363e2cd66b2657f61f79027086a33afc5a60d4daff98751c4678de0e594eab36:1
  • value  25793405
    address  1HWiMTR8vxiGdCQp3LH67w7A7cohumFa8u